Govee makes other lights for that. These are typically displayed on the wall in whatever fun design you can come up with. Just my two cents.
What is the use case for these? I see gaming in the title but I'm struggling to understand where you would put them.
Kids like things like this in their bedrooms. They do look cool on the wall and go well with other smart lighting. We have Govee light strips under the kids' beds to illuminate the ground. With the available scenes, it all comes together nicely.
This is the normal price for them! Bought two sets this summer at this price. Govee jacks them up them discounts them. Grrrrr
CamelCamelCamel states $60 average price but I didn't know about these until they went on sale. I like them, pretty good for the price. Only thing I do not like is that you only get 2 connectors so you pretty much have to have 3 linked up since there are 6 bars total.
